Affect and effect are two of the most commonly confused words in english, but don’t worry—we’ll help you keep them straight

The basic difference is this Affect is usually a verb, and effect is usually a noun. Affect is most often a verb meaning “to influence or produce change,” while effect is primarily a noun referring to a result or consequence Delve into other uses, like effect as a verb to bring about change and affect as a noun for an emotional state.

Affect is usually used as a verb meaning to influence or produce a change in something, whereas effect is generally used as a noun that refers to a change resulting from something.
